Major Economic Decisions Shaping 2026
The One Big Beautiful Bill Act: Fiscal Policy Reset
The enactment of the One Big Beautiful Bill Act in July 2025 represents the most significant fiscal policy shift in recent decades. This legislation permanently extended expiring individual income tax provisions and fundamentally altered business investment incentives through full expensing of capital investments, including equipment, research, and development expenditures.
Economic Impact: The Congressional Budget Office projects the legislation will add approximately $3.4 trillion to the federal deficit over the next decade, excluding debt service costs. However, the immediate economic effects are notable, with business investment growth expected at 4.4% in 2025 and 4% in 2026, driven primarily by enhanced capital expenditure provisions.
For businesses, this policy creates significant opportunities for capital-intensive investments, particularly in technology infrastructure, manufacturing capabilities, and research facilities. Organizations that strategically leverage these provisions are positioning themselves for long-term competitive advantages as the economy transitions toward higher productivity growth models.
Tariff Restructuring and Trade Realignment
The tariff landscape has undergone dramatic transformation, with average effective rates rising from approximately 2.5% at the start of 2025 to over 10% by August, with projections suggesting rates could reach 15% by the first quarter of 2026. This represents the most significant shift in U.S. trade policy since the post-World War II period.
The economic implications are multifaceted. While businesses initially built inventory ahead of tariff implementations, creating temporary demand surges, the sustained elevation of tariff rates is fundamentally altering supply chain economics. Import growth is projected to decline by 0.6% in 2026, while export growth slows to 0.3%, reflecting the broader impact of trade policy uncertainty on global commerce.
Trade Dynamics: Global trade growth, which reached 3.8% in 2025 through front-loading effects, is projected to slow to 2.2% in 2026 as businesses adjust to the new tariff environment and elevated policy uncertainty constrains investment decisions.
Companies are responding through strategic supply chain diversification, nearshoring initiatives, and investment in domestic production capabilities. The organizations that successfully navigate this transition are those implementing comprehensive supply chain risk management frameworks and maintaining flexibility in sourcing strategies.
Immigration Policy and Labor Market Transformation
Reduced net immigration represents another major policy shift with profound economic implications. Lower immigration flows are constraining labor supply growth, contributing to persistent wage pressures and influencing business investment decisions. Organizations are responding through accelerated automation, enhanced training programs, and more strategic workforce planning.
The labor market is experiencing a fundamental shift as businesses increasingly view technology and capital investment as substitutes for labor in response to tighter supply conditions. This is accelerating the adoption of artificial intelligence, robotics, and automation technologies across virtually all industry sectors.

Tokenized Assets and Real-World Asset (RWA) Tokenization
Asset tokenization is transitioning from experimental pilot programs to mainstream financial infrastructure. The total value of tokenized real-world assets reached approximately $24 billion in 2025, with projections suggesting the market could reach $16 trillion by 2030. This represents one of the most significant structural changes in capital markets since the digitization of securities trading.
Tokenization is democratizing access to traditionally illiquid assets including real estate, private equity, commodities, and fine art. Retail investors can now purchase fractional ownership of multi-million dollar properties for as little as $1,000, fundamentally altering investment accessibility and market liquidity.
Stablecoin Regulation and Adoption
The GENIUS Act enacted in July 2025 established the first comprehensive regulatory framework for stablecoins, requiring federal or state regulatory supervision and 100% reserve banking with liquid assets. Permitted Payment Stablecoin Issuers (PPSI) must implement robust anti-money laundering programs, necessitating substantial investments in compliance infrastructure.
Market Transformation: The fintech market, valued at $394.88 billion in 2025, is projected to reach $1,126.64 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 16.2%. Stablecoins are enabling international money transfers with the speed and simplicity of domestic transactions, with cross-border payments that once took days now completing instantaneously at fractional costs.
Real-Time Payment Infrastructure
Bank-based instant payment systems including RTP and FedNow are moving beyond early adoption to become standard infrastructure for payroll, liquidity management, supplier payments, and treasury operations. The shift from traditional ACH processing to real-time settlement is transforming business operations and cash flow management.
Request for Pay (RFP) functionality is gaining significant traction in commercial payments, enabling real-time, pay-by-bank experiences that reduce reliance on card networks and improve cash flow efficiency for corporations across all industries.

Live Commerce and Social Shopping
Livestream shopping has evolved from niche experiment to core sales channel. U.S. livestreaming e-commerce sales reached $50 billion in 2023 and are projected to grow to $68 billion by 2026. Global analysts estimate live commerce could account for 10-20% of total e-commerce sales by 2026 in high-adoption markets.
Conversion Performance: Livestream shopping events are achieving conversion rates of up to 30%, compared to just 2-3% for traditional e-commerce, demonstrating the powerful combination of entertainment, education, and instant gratification that live commerce provides.
Major retailers including Walmart, Nordstrom, and Amazon have launched dedicated livestream shopping programs, while social platforms like Instagram, TikTok, and Facebook continue expanding their live shopping capabilities. The format proves particularly effective for products benefiting from demonstration, including beauty, fashion, and electronics.
Omnichannel Integration and Physical Retail Evolution
Digital-native brands are expanding into physical retail through strategic pop-ups, wholesale partnerships, flagship stores, and experiential events. This reflects the recognition that pure-play direct-to-consumer models are hitting diminishing returns as digital acquisition costs continue rising, with Meta CPM up 22.58% year-over-year and Google CPA up 17.25%.
Physical stores are evolving into experiential hubs for product interaction, brand events, and seamless online return processing. The most successful retailers are designing ecosystems that leverage the strengths of both physical and digital channels, creating cohesive omnichannel experiences.
Operational Excellence as Competitive Advantage
E-commerce success in 2026 increasingly depends on execution capacity rather than demand generation. Businesses with scalable systems, reliable fulfillment, and responsive operations are positioned to grow, while those lacking operational readiness face growth constraints from their own infrastructure limitations.
Distributed and regionalized fulfillment networks are becoming essential as rising shipping costs, tariff uncertainty, and delivery-time expectations push businesses away from centralized warehousing. Inventory placement closer to end customers is reducing transit times, managing risk, and maintaining consistent service across regions.

Manufacturing & Industrial Technology
Manufacturing is experiencing revolutionary transformation through Industry 5.0 principles, combining human expertise with intelligent automation to achieve unprecedented levels of precision and resilience.
Industry 5.0 and Human-Machine Collaboration
Industry 5.0 has shifted focus from pure automation to seamless collaboration between humans and intelligent machines. This approach is driving the Industrial IoT (IIoT) market toward $191.4 billion by 2026, as manufacturers prioritize resilience and millisecond-level precision in production systems.
AI-powered computer vision systems now detect and measure micro-defects as small as 0.08mm to 0.6mm, levels of sensitivity previously impossible without manual microscopic inspection. This level of precision is expected to reduce waste in high-precision electronics manufacturing by up to 30%.
Operational Impact: Manufacturers are investing in systems capable of autonomous operation during supply-chain disruptions, with resilience becoming the new key performance indicator. The mandate for 2026 is clear: software excellence is the ultimate differentiator in manufacturing competitiveness.
